#homegooglemap #tmmap{height:570px!important;width:100%;}@media (max-width: 991px) {#homegooglemap #tmmap{height:500px!important;}}@media (max-width: 767px) {#homegooglemap #tmmap{height:450px!important;}}@media (max-width: 479px) {#homegooglemap #tmmap{height:380px!important;}}#homegooglemap #tmmap .marker_content{width:300px;color:#181818;}@media (min-width: 1200px) {#homegooglemap #tmmap .marker_content{min-height:240px;}}#homegooglemap #tmmap .marker_content .tmgooglemap-hours{column-count:2;}#homegooglemap #tmmap .marker_content .tmgooglemap-hours p{margin-bottom:5px;}#homegooglemap #tmmap .marker_content .tmlink-directions{color:#c5a47e;}#homegooglemap #tmmap .marker_content .clearfix{margin-bottom:5px;}#homegooglemap #tmmap .marker_content .marker_logo{float:left;margin-right:5px;width:45%;height:auto;}#homegooglemap #tmmap .marker_content b{display:block;}#homegooglemap #tmmap .marker_content .description{width:50%;float:left;}#homegooglemap #tmmap .marker_content>p{font-size:11px;margin-bottom:5px;width:50%;float:left;padding-right:10px;}